  • Don't firefighters usually carry PASS devices as a means of locating a firefighter who falls or becomes incapacitated

  • @snakes3425 im a firefighter in pennsylvania at the time this happened PASS devices were still very new and expensive. so not alot of companies have them, now a days after 30 seconds of being motionless our PASS devices start going off
